The 8 Basic Tennis Shots & Skills (Explained) - My Tennis HQ
One important step is to first establish the difference between tennis shots and strokes. While people may disagree on this topic, most believe that there are only possible 6 tennis strokes you can hit: serve, forehand, backhand, forehand volley, backhand volley, and overhead.
